RE Act definition

RE Act shall have the meaning given to that term in the recitals hereto.
RE Act means the Rural Electrification Act of 1936 (7 U.S.C. 901 et seq.).
RE Act means the Rural Electrifica- tion Act of 1936 as amended (7 U.S.C. 901 et seq.).
